Subject: Idempotency keys for payment retries — shipped

Team: Quillpay retries now require idempotency keys. Duplicate charges from the Fernmont incident are no longer possible; the gateway rejects retries lacking a key. Keys live 24h in the dedupe store. Client libraries updated; older SDKs get a deprecation warning until next quarter. Rollout completed across all regions this morning, zero errors observed. Discuss migration stragglers at Thursday's sync. Build token for this release follows below.

session token of tajef-bageg = htk21_5d90d574934f3ccae6437

Subject: Websocket reconnect fix shipping in tonight's release

Hi all,

Tonight's release of Bramblecast fixes the websocket reconnect bug reported by the Quillhaven pilot group. Clients dropped from the relay were retrying with a stale session handle, causing silent disconnects after roughly ten minutes. The reconnect handler now requests a fresh handle before retrying. Contractors validating the fix should confirm their test clients are running the patched build. The build token to verify against is below.

trace token, kahog-tajeg: htk6_97d963

- [ ] **Verify tailcat release artifact.** Before tagging, confirm the tailcat CLI builds reproducibly on both supported runners and that `tailcat --follow` handles log rotation without dropping lines (regression in 2.3.0). Future maintainers: the integration suite in `ci/tail_rotation` must pass twice consecutively. Record the passing pipeline run in the release notes so audits can trace it. The build token for the signed artifact goes directly below.

pipeline stamp: htk31_f769b577b3028a4e9958e5bb8d1259a

Welcome to the Fabrikelle team. Our test-data factory library, Seedloom, generates deterministic fixtures for every release candidate; always pin the generator version in the release manifest. Regeneration scripts live under tools/seedloom and must be run before tagging. If the fixture vault prompts for unlock during a release cut, use the recovery passphrase below, which we keep inline for the on-call rotation.

strongbox words: istwyn-normir-silwyn-ulaius-istwyn